Stuff olives with the onion and set aside. 2. Blend the flour, salt, and mustard together in a bowl. Mix in the cheese, then stir in a mixture of the butter or margarine, milk and Tabasco. 3. Using about a teaspoonful of dough for each, shape dough around olives and place on a baking sheet. 4. Bake at 400F 10 to 12 min. Serve immediately. tS Olive Bites Glazed Canapes The glaze on these canape's serves three functions: it is the mark of a professional, it helps retain the freshness of the canape's, and it adds eye appeal. If the glaze is omitted, the flavor of the canapis will be equally good. Clear glaze Soften 1 tablespoon (1 env.) unflavored gelatin in cup cold water in a bowl. Pour 1 cup boil ing water over softened gelatin and stir until gelatin is dissolved. Chill until slightly thickened. How to glaze canapes Place canapes on cooling racks over large shallow pans. Working quickly, spoon about 2 teaspoons of slightly thickened gelatin over each can ape. Have ready a bowl of ice and water and a bowl of hot water. The gelatin may have to be set over one or the other during glazing to maintain the proper consistency. The gelatin should cling slightly to canapes when spoon ed over them. Gelatin may be scooped up and reused as it collects in bottom of pan. Whipped butter Whip chilled firm butter using an electric mixer at high speed just until the butter is fluffy and of spreading consistency. Smoked Ham Whip together V4 cup whipped butter, Vi cup spiced peach sirup, and 2 tablespoons sieved spiced peach. Spread peach butter onto toasted bread diamonds. Top with a thin slice of smoked ham and garnish with pimien-to-stuffed olive slices, sprinkled with snipped parsley. Glaze and chill canapes. Roast Beef -Oyster Whip together Vi cup whipped butter, 2 teaspoons crush ed tarragon leaves, and 4 teaspoon freshly ground black pepper until just blended. Spread onto toasted bread squares. Top with a thin slice of roast beef. Sprinkle the center with snipped parsley and top with a smoked oyster. Glaze and chill. Egg and Sardine Mix together 3 sieved hard-cooked eggs, 2 tablespoons mayonnaise. Hi teaspoons tomato paste, '4 teaspoon lemon juice, and Vi teaspoon salt. Spread onto toasted bread ovals. Place a small sardine, topped with grated lemon peel, in the center of each. Glaze and chill. Anchovy Spread toasted bread triangles with whipped unsalted butter.
